FAQs – Houses for Sale Waterloo
1. What is the average home price in Waterloo? Prices range from $750,000 to $1.1M for detached homes, depending on location, size, and upgrades.
2. Is Waterloo a good city for families? Yes. Waterloo is known for excellent schools, low crime rates, and plenty of parks and community programs for children.
3. What neighbourhoods are best for buying a house in Waterloo? Top areas include Laurelwood, Beechwood, Vista Hills, and Columbia Forest.
4. Are there new developments in Waterloo? Yes. Waterloo continues to expand, especially in its western communities, offering energy-efficient and smart-home-ready builds.
